What is residential canal dredging?

Dredging is the removal of accumulated sediment — sand, silt, mud, and organic muck — from the bottom of a waterway to restore its original depth. On a residential canal, that usually means clearing a boat slip, a channel, or a stretch of canal that has filled in over years of tidal deposition and stormwater runoff.

Canals silt in for predictable reasons on this coast. Every incoming tide carries fine sediment that settles out in the quieter water behind a seawall. Stormwater sheeting off yards and streets drops its load where the flow slows. Dead-end and finger canals flush poorly, so what settles tends to stay. And a single hurricane can redistribute a canal bottom overnight. Over a decade, a slip that floated a center console easily can lose a foot or more of depth without anyone noticing until the boat starts touching.

How do I know if my canal or boat slip has silted in?

The clearest signs are a boat that floats at high tide but grounds at low, props that kick up mud in water that used to run clear, and a measured depth at mean low water that’s noticeably shallower than it was a few years ago.

Watch for these:

  • You can only leave and return in the couple of hours around high tide.
  • The lower unit or keel drags or stirs bottom leaving the slip.
  • A sounding pole or depth finder reads less depth at mean low water than you remember.
  • Mudflats or grass flats sit exposed at low tide where there used to be open water.
  • Your boat lift cradle bottoms out before the hull floats — often a depth problem, not a lift problem. (See boat lift for shallow water and low tide.)

The key is to measure at mean low water, not at a sunny high-tide look from the seawall. The number that decides whether your slip works is the depth at the bottom of the tide, and on Gulf-fed SW Florida canals the swing between high and low can easily run a couple of feet or more.

Mechanical vs. hydraulic dredging: which method fits a residential canal?

The two main approaches are mechanical dredging — an excavator, backhoe, or clamshell physically scoops sediment out — and hydraulic dredging — a suction pump moves a water-sediment slurry through a pipeline to a disposal site. Which one fits depends on the volume of material, the sediment type, and how accessible your canal is.

Consideration Mechanical dredging Hydraulic dredging
How it works Excavator, backhoe, or clamshell scoops sediment into a barge or truck A cutterhead or suction pump moves a slurry through a pipeline
Best for Smaller volumes, debris, firmer material, tight residential slips Larger volumes, fine silt, longer runs
Access needed Barge or land access for the machine Room for a pipeline plus a dewatering and disposal site
Sediment stirred up Can re-suspend more; often paired with turbidity curtains Contained in the pipeline; can be lower when well managed

Wherever the sediment goes, it can’t simply be pushed to the side of the canal. Dredged material — the industry calls it spoil — typically has to be dewatered and hauled to an approved upland disposal site, and it may need testing to confirm it’s clean fill. Disposal is frequently one of the biggest items in a dredging quote, which is why the cost of a job is driven by depth of cut, volume of material, sediment type, disposal method, and site access — not the length of the canal alone. If you get quotes, expect those factors to move the number far more than the address does.

What permits does canal dredging require in Florida?

Dredging in Florida waters almost always requires environmental review. As a general rule, expect state review through the Florida Department of Environmental Protection (FDEP), often a federal review by the U.S. Army Corps of Engineers when the work touches navigable waters, and county or municipal involvement — plus authorization to disturb state-owned submerged lands.

Why so much oversight? Because moving a canal bottom stirs up sediment and can affect protected resources. A few things commonly come into play:

  • State environmental review (FDEP) for dredge-and-fill work in state waters.
  • Federal review (U.S. Army Corps of Engineers) where the waterway is navigable.
  • County or city involvement, which varies by canal and jurisdiction.
  • Sovereign submerged lands — Florida owns most bottomlands under navigable waters, so using them can require separate authorization.
  • Seagrass surveys and manatee protections, which can restrict both the method and the season the work is allowed. (See our guides on the seagrass survey for a dock permit and manatee zones and permits by county.)

This is exactly why permitting a dredge is more involved than permitting a simple dock repair. Requirements, agency roles, and seasonal windows change, and they vary from one waterway to the next. Confirm the current rules with FDEP and your county — and make sure any contractor you hire pulls the proper permits in their own name — before a single bucket of material is moved. How do I vet a licensed dredging contractor?

Hire a contractor who is licensed and insured for marine excavation, pulls the permits in their own name, carries the right environmental controls, and gives you a written scope covering volume, disposal, and turbidity protection.

Run down this checklist before you sign:

  • Licensing and insurance for marine or underwater excavation — verify it, don’t take it on faith.
  • Who pulls the permits — it should be them, not you.
  • The disposal plan — where the spoil goes, and who pays to haul it.
  • Environmental controls — turbidity curtains, and seagrass and manatee compliance where they apply.
  • A written scope — the area, target depth, method, and an honest volume estimate.
  • References on similar residential canal jobs, ideally on your own waterway system.

It’s the same diligence you’d apply to any waterfront contractor — the questions are just tuned to excavation instead of construction.

Where do docks and boat lifts fit once your depth is restored?

Once a dredging contractor restores your depth, the numbers they measured — depth at mean low water, bottom type, and tidal swing — become the exact inputs for designing a dock and lift that use that depth for decades.

That’s the handoff where we come in. Your restored depth sets how deep the pilings go, how high the lift cradle rides so it clears the bottom at low tide, whether a fixed or floating dock suits the slip, and where along the seawall the deepest water sits so the slip lands in the right spot. Solving the depth is step one; engineering the structure to make the most of it is step two — and doing them in that order means you don’t build a dock and lift for a depth that’s about to change.
